Analysis

In 2025, lab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) in Myanmar stood at 69.7%. That is the lowest value across all 36 years on record.

That represents a change of down 0.1% on the previous year and down 11.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) in Myanmar peaked at 79.5% in 2007 and was at its lowest, 69.7%, in 2025.

Myanmar ranks 98th of 187 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 36 years of available data.

Lab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) in Myanmar, year by year

Annual values for Lab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) (modeled ILO estimate) in Myanmar, 1990 to 2025.
Year Value Change
1990 77.0%
1991 76.9% -0.1%
1992 77.2% +0.4%
1993 77.4% +0.2%
1994 77.6% +0.3%
1995 77.7% +0.2%
1996 77.9% +0.2%
1997 78.0% +0.2%
1998 78.2% +0.2%
1999 78.4% +0.3%
2000 78.7% +0.4%
2001 78.9% +0.3%
2002 79.1% +0.2%
2003 79.2% +0.2%
2004 79.4% +0.2%
2005 79.5% +0.1%
2006 79.5% +0.1%
2007 79.5% +0.0%
2008 79.5% -0.0%
2009 79.4% -0.1%
2010 79.4% -0.1%
2011 79.3% -0.1%
2012 79.3% -0.1%
2013 79.2% -0.1%
2014 79.1% -0.1%
2015 79.0% -0.1%
2016 77.9% -1.4%
2017 76.7% -1.4%
2018 76.6% -0.1%
2019 75.1% -2.0%
2020 76.0% +1.2%
2021 69.7% -8.2%
2022 69.8% +0.1%
2023 69.7% -0.0%
2024 69.7% -0.0%
2025 69.7% -0.1%

Labor force participation rate is the proportion of the population ages 15 and older that is economically active: all people who supply labor for the production of goods and services during a specified period.
